深入分析VPN协议:OpenVPN、L2TP与WireGuard的优劣比较

# 深入分析VPN协议:OpenVPN、L2TP与WireGuard的优劣比较
在现代网络安全中,虚拟专用网络(VPN)技术越来越受到关注。VPN不仅可以保护用户的在线隐私,还可以绕过地理限制,实现安全的远程访问。本文将深入分析三种常见的VPN协议:OpenVPN、L2TP和WireGuard,探讨它们各自的优缺点,以帮助用户选择最适合自己的VPN协议。
## 一、OpenVPN
### 优点
1. **开源**:OpenVPN是一个开源项目,意味着其源代码可供任何人查看和修改,这增强了其安全性和透明度。
2. **灵活性**:OpenVPN支持多种加密算法和身份验证方法,用户可以根据自己的需求进行配置。
3. **防火墙穿透能力强**:OpenVPN可以通过TCP和UDP协议进行传输,具备较强的防火墙穿透能力,适合在严格的网络环境中使用。
4. **广泛支持**:OpenVPN在各种操作系统(包括Windows、Linux、macOS、Android和iOS)上都有良好的支持。
### 缺点
1. **配置复杂**:相比其他协议,OpenVPN的配置过程较为复杂,尤其对于新手用户来说。
2. **性能开销**:由于其灵活性和强大的加密功能,OpenVPN在某些情况下可能会导致性能下降。
## 二、L2TP/IPsec
### 优点
1. **安全性高**:L2TP通常与IPsec结合使用,提供了良好的数据加密和安全性。
2. **易于配置**:相比OpenVPN,L2TP的配置相对简单,许多操作系统内置了对L2TP的支持。
3. **稳定性好**:L2TP协议相对稳定,适合长时间连接。
### 缺点
1. **速度较慢**:由于L2TP/IPsec的加密方式,数据传输速度可能会受到影响,尤其是在高延迟网络环境下。
2. **防火墙穿透能力差**:某些网络环境中,L2TP可能会被防火墙阻止,影响连接的可靠性。
3. **开源性不足**:L2TP并不是完全开源的,这在一定程度上影响了其透明度。
## 三、WireGuard
### 优点
1. **高效性**:WireGuard设计简洁,性能优越,能够提供更快的连接速度和更低的延迟。
2. **易于配置**:WireGuard的配置相对简单,用户友好,适合技术水平不高的用户。
3. **现代加密技术**:WireGuard使用最新的加密协议,提供强大的安全性,且代码量小,减少了潜在的安全漏洞。
### 缺点
1. **新兴技术**:作为较新的协议,WireGuard的成熟度和社区支持尚不及OpenVPN。
2. **不兼容旧设备**:由于WireGuard需要新的内核支持,某些旧设备可能无法使用。
## 四、总结
在选择VPN协议时,用户需要根据自己的需求和环境进行权衡。OpenVPN适合需要高安全性和灵活性的用户,尤其是在复杂网络环境中;L2TP/IPsec则适合那些重视简单配置和稳定性的用户;而WireGuard则是追求高性能和现代化体验用户的理想选择。
总体来说,没有绝对完美的VPN协议,只有最适合的选择。希望本文能为您在选择VPN协议时提供一定的参考。


发表评论